Andy Ruiz: First Mexicano/Chicano Heavyweight Champion Of The World.

Andy Ruiz: 'I am the first Mexican Heavyweight Champion Of The World' utters Chicano from Imperial Valley, California, after defeating, in a TKO, reigning champ Anthony Joshua.

"First Mexicano/Chicano Heavyweight Of The World."

Ruiz continues to be adamant that he is the first "Mexican heavyweight champion", acknowledging that he will visit Mexico to meet with Mexican president, Andres Manuel Lopez Obrador at Palacio Presidencial.

From CBS, Andy Ruiz' career is summarized: "Ruiz's record is nothing to brush to the side at 32-1 with 21 knockouts. The one loss shouldn't be ignored, either. Ruiz challenged for a world championship previously in his career, battling Joseph Parker in December 2016 for the then-vacant WBO heavyweight title. Parker emerged as champion via majority decision, although many came away from that fight believing Ruiz had dominated enough of the early and championship rounds to earn the victory -- or, at the very least, a draw."
